我正在使用节点从url加载html页面。这是我的代码:
request({
url : url,
timeout: 2000
}, function(error, response, html){
console.log(html);
});
但是当我跑步时,它似乎扼杀了角色 1 。我认为这不是UTF-8。我该如何解决呢?
示例网址:http://news.zing.vn/Nhung-hinh-anh-giau-cam-xuc-o-vong-17-VLeague-post560640.html
答案 0 :(得分:0)
问题是服务器正在以压缩格式(gzip)返回响应,即使您没有通过请求标头专门请求它。
要解决此问题,您可以使用gzip
的{{1}}选项:
request